Mandatory Advising for Ag Majors

All students in Agricultural Business, Animal Science, Agricultural Science, and Plant and Soil Science are required to meet with an advisor before fall registration begins.

  • 1. Meet with the Student Success and Retention Office

    To get help planning your schedule or understanding requirements, visit the SSRO office or Book an Appointment.

  • 2. Meet with Your Faculty Advisor

    In early October, your faculty advisor will send an email with details about how to schedule your advising appointment.

    If you are an animal science student, you will be assigned an SSRO advisor for your first two years.

  • 3. Be Ready to Register

    Log in to your Student Center to view your registration date and time. View the Class Schedule to browse course availability and times.
